This is for you if… your phone takes ages to open apps, type messages or load photos.
I was helping someone in Arlesey whose phone felt painfully slow, but the biggest problem was not the age of the phone. It had almost no free storage left.
Start with storage
When a phone is nearly full, it can slow down. Check Settings for storage and look for large videos, downloaded TV shows, duplicate photos and unused apps.
Update, then restart
Updates often fix performance problems. After updating, restart the phone properly. It sounds simple, but it clears temporary issues.
Look for one troublesome app
If the phone slows down after opening one particular app, update that app or remove and reinstall it. Too many browser tabs can also make an older phone feel heavy.
Check battery health
On some phones, an old battery can affect performance. If the battery is very worn, replacing the battery may be better value than replacing the whole phone.
